Softball Recap: Wills Point Tigers vs. Caddo Mills Foxes
Wills Point was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They lost 10-4 to the Caddo Mills Foxes.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Foxes this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 4-3 on March 7th.
Addison Shields made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and went 2-for-3 with two runs and one triple. That triple was her first of the season. Another player making a difference was Dakota Hemmi, who went 2-for-4 with two doubles.
Wills Point's loss dropped their record down to 5-12-1. As for Caddo Mills, with the victory, they broke their four-game losing streak and moved their record to 9-12-1.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. A feisty cat fight will be fought as Wills Point Tigers take on Ford Panthers at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Caddo Mills, they will challenge Community at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Community's pitching crew has only allowed 3.7 runs per game this season, so Caddo Mills' hitters will have their work cut out for them.
